Wiktionary
NATO, proper noun. Acronym of w:North Atlantic Treaty Organization.
NATO, noun. (countable) A tree the genus Mora
NATO, noun. (uncountable) The wood of such trees
NATO, acronym. Alternative spelling of NATO
NATO PHONETIC ALPHABET, proper noun. The ICAO spelling alphabet.
NATO REPORTING NAME, noun. Code names used by NATO to identify Soviet and Chinese military equipment
Dictionary definition
NATO, noun. An international organization created in 1949 by the North Atlantic Treaty for purposes of collective security.
